NGC 7023
NGC 7023, commonly known as the Iris Nebula, is a bright reflection nebula located in the constellation Cepheus. The surrounding dust clouds reflect the blue light of the central star, HD 200775. It is a popular target for amateur astrophotographers due to its distinct blue coloration and surrounding dark dust lanes. The nebula is situated approximately 1,300 light-years from Earth.

Ghost Nebula
The Ghost Nebula, formally Sh2-136 or vdB 141, is a stunning reflection nebula located within the Cepheus constellation. It’s notable for its ethereal appearance created by starlight reflecting off dense dust clouds. These nebulae often contain nascent stars forming within them.
